Finding and Buying IEWC Military Surplus

Alright, now that we're all fired up about IEWC military surplus, let's talk about the practicalities of finding and buying it. Where do you find this stuff, and how do you make sure you're getting a good deal? The landscape has evolved, but the core principles remain the same: research, patience, and a bit of savvy. One of the best places to start is online. There are many online retailers specializing in military surplus. These sites often offer a wide selection, detailed product descriptions, and customer reviews. This can be super convenient, especially if you have a specific item in mind. Brick-and-mortar stores are still awesome. These stores allow you to inspect items in person, assess their condition, and get a feel for the quality. Plus, you might find some hidden gems that aren’t listed online. Auctions, both online and in-person, can be another great source. Government surplus auctions often offer significant discounts, but it's important to understand the terms and conditions before bidding. Classified ads and local marketplaces are other possibilities. These can be a great way to find deals on individual items, but always exercise caution and inspect the items before purchasing. Whatever method you choose, it’s crucial to research the items you're interested in. Understand the original specifications, read reviews, and compare prices. Inspect items carefully before purchasing. Look for signs of wear and tear, and ask questions about the item's history. Knowing the item's origin and potential use will help you assess its value. Compare prices from different sources to ensure you’re getting a fair deal. Prices can vary widely, so it pays to shop around. With a little research and careful shopping, you can build your own collection of high-quality gear. Maintaining and Caring for Your Surplus Gear

Alright, you've got your IEWC military surplus gear – now what? Just like any quality gear, taking good care of it will extend its lifespan and ensure it performs well. Proper maintenance is key to preserving the value and functionality of your items. Let's talk about the specific care guidelines. For clothing, always follow the care instructions on the labels. Military surplus clothing often requires specific washing and drying methods, so it's best to follow these guidelines to avoid damaging the materials. For footwear, regularly clean your boots to remove dirt and debris. Use appropriate cleaning products and conditioners to maintain the leather and keep your boots in good shape. Camping and outdoor equipment benefit from regular cleaning and storage. After each use, clean and dry your tent, sleeping bag, and other gear. Store your gear in a cool, dry place to prevent mold and mildew. Tools and equipment also require care. Keep your tools clean and well-maintained. Sharpen blades, lubricate moving parts, and store them properly to protect them from the elements. Regular inspections are also crucial. Inspect your gear regularly for any signs of wear and tear, damage, or malfunction. Repair minor issues promptly to prevent them from becoming major problems. Consider these tips as a routine. Taking care of your gear not only extends its life, but it also helps you maximize its performance and ensure that it’s ready when you need it. By following these care guidelines, you can keep your IEWC military surplus gear in top condition. This ensures that your investments continue to serve you well for years to come.
